HomeMy WebLinkAboutORDINANCE 1945-2001Suggested by: Administration CITY OF KENAI ORDINANCE N0. 1945-2001 .AN ORDINANCE OF TH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F KENAI, ALASKA, INCREASING ESTIMATED REVENUES AND APPROPRIATIONS IN THE AMOUNT OF ~ 10,000 IN THE GENERAL FUND FOR PURCHASE OF FURNITURE AND EQUIPMENT FOR DOWNSTAIRS OFFICE SPACE AT CITY HALL. WHEREAS, the downstairs office space, recently vacated by the Kenai Public Health Service, is being renovated to use as the Office of the City Clerk, and will house space for a copy room, record management operations and Council office space as well; and, WHEREAS, funds outside of the costs for renovation are required to purchase office and kitchen furniture, kitchen equipment, cupboards, countertops, shelving, phones, and miscellaneous office equipment. N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F KENAI, ALASKA, that estimated revenues and appropriations be increased in the General Fund as follows: General Fund Increase Estimated Revenues: Appropriation of Fund Balance ~ 10,000 Increase Appropriations: Buildings -Building Improvements ~ 1, 500 Clerk -Small Tools ~ 8, 500 PASSED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F KENAI, ALASKA, this second day of January, 2002.
